This Small Batch Spiced Molasses Gingerbread Muffins recipe yields six soft and fluffy muffins are assertively spiced with ginger, c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ves, and topped with turbinado sugar - in just 30 minutes!

all purpose flour baking soda ground ginger ground cinnamon ground nutmeg ground cloves salt molasses unsalted butter plain Greek yogurt milk brown sugar apple cider vinegar vanilla extract turbinado sugar

1. Preheat the oven to 375°F. Line or grease every other cup of a 12-cup muffin tin. 2. In a medium bowl, whisk together dry ingredients: flour, baking soda, ginger, cinnamon, nutmeg, cloves, and salt. Set aside.

3. In a large microwave-safe bowl, melt the butter and molasses together in 20-second increments. Once melted, whisk in the Greek yogurt, milk, brown sugar, vinegar, and vanilla extract until smooth.

4. Add the dry ingredients to the bowl with the wet and stir together with a rubber spatula until a batter forms.

5. Let the batter sit at room temperature for 15-20 minutes before scooping for tallest muffins.

6. Spoon the batter equally into the 6 muffin cups. Top each with a generous sprinkle of turbinado or granulated sugar.

7. Bake for 375°F (190°C) for 18-20 minutes until domed and set. A toothpick inserted in the center should come out clean or with just a couple crumbs attached.
